Publication number: 20240133899Abstract: The present disclosure provides methods and systems for diagnosing diseases and monitoring their progression and therapeutic responses by detecting a presence or absence, or an increase or decrease, of one or more substances in a sample. The methods may involve microflow liquid chromatography (LC) coupled with mass spectrometry (MS) to rapidly quantitate biomarkers in a sample and identify the likelihood of the sample being positive for a disease or condition.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 10, 2023Publication date: April 25, 2024Inventors: Daojing WANG, Pan MAO, Weimin NI

Patent number: 9353133Abstract: This invention relates to compounds useful for treating fungal infections, more specifically topical treatment of onychomycosis and/or cutaneous fungal infections. This invention is directed to compounds that are active against fungi and have properties that allow the compound, when placed in contact with a patient, to reach the particular part of the skin, nail, hair, claw or hoof infected by the fungus. In particular the present compounds have physiochemical properties that facilitate penetration of the nail plate.Type: GrantFiled: March 7, 2014Date of Patent: May 31, 2016Assignee: Anacor Pharmaceuticals, Inc.Inventors: Stephen J.
